Puri, April 21(BNP):The construction of the sacred chariots for the 2026 Rath Yatra officially commenced on April 20, coinciding with the auspicious occasion of Akshaya Tritiya.
The rituals began with the traditional ‘Rath Katha Anukula’ ceremony on the Grand Road (Bada Danda), where the atmosphere resonated with devotional chants and prayers. The process was marked by the ceremonial use of a golden axe by the Biswakarma Sevaks, who performed the first strike on selected logs (Dhaura Katha), symbolizing the beginning of chariot construction.
The rituals were conducted after the arrival of the ‘Agyan Mala’ (garland of consent) from Lord Jagannath at the main temple, signifying divine approval. Priests also performed a sacred yagna (fire ritual) near the Rath Khala area in front of the Puri King’s palace before the cutting of the wood commenced.
This marks the formal beginning of preparations for the grand festival, with the construction of three majestic chariots—Nandighosha (45.6 ft) for Lord Jagannath, Taladhwaja (45 ft) for Lord Balabhadra, and Darpadalana (44.6 ft) for Goddess Subhadra.
The commencement of chariot construction signals the start of one of the most revered religious events, drawing millions of devotees from across the country and beyond.
